Is it possible to get a license for Workstation 16 when having bought a license for Workstation 17?

I have just bought a license for VMware Workstation 17, but for the sake of stability I'd like to use Workstation 16 if possible in the near term future.

If I had known Workstation 17 was around the corner I'd have bought a license just before as I know you do upgrade licenses if bought recently leading up to the next version.

Would this be possible to facilitate in any way? I hope, it'd give extra peace of mind knowing problems won't suddenly arise.

What you need to do is to downgrade the license in the portal, so that you get a key for version 16.
